How to Find the Drawn in Winter Unique Axe in Avowed
In the game Avowed, players can discover the distinctive Winter Axe in the Watcher’s Mirror site, which is located in Dawnshore, specifically southeast of the Shrine to Woedica. This location is part of the Untimely Demise quest’s objective A where players hunt for the Watcher. Acquiring the axe is quite simple, but escaping the area post-retrieval may require some finesse due to potential enemy ambushes. Here’s a guide on how you can secure the axe and navigate the subsequent enemy attack.
Interact with Ancient Memory & Take the Drawn in Winter Axe
To make navigation simpler, consider beginning your journey at the quick-travel point close to the Shrine of Woedica in Avowed. Once there, face east and proceed towards the cave entrance. Continue straight ahead until you notice a white archway.
As they pass under the arch, players will find themselves at the location known as the Watcher’s Mirror. Here, there’s a tranquil pond in the center and an old memory at the end. Engage with this ancient memory to acquire the Remembrance of Kishamal, a divine passive skill that boosts your maximum health by 10%.
Upon gaining that capability, please face the opposite direction and make your way back. There, you’ll find an ice pillar jutting out from the pond, with the distinctive Winter Drawn axe resting at its peak. Grab it and put on the axe to start using it right away. Survive the Skeleton Soldiers Ambush
Once you’ve picked up the axe, you’ll find skeletal soldiers emerging from within the pond. To obtain valuable items later on, it’s essential that you eliminate all the adversaries. Besides ordinary soldiers, there are also mages who can heal the foot soldiers to full health. Be sure to focus on eliminating the mages first, thus hindering the other soldiers from receiving healing.
Ensure you wear adequate armor and keep your energy level at its peak to have a fighting chance against the surprise attack. After that, feel free to depart from the Watcher’s location in the game ‘Avowed’.
